330.180 Seal -- Records, as evidence, public. The board shall adopt a seal by which it shall authenticate its proceedings. Copies of all records and papers in the office of the board, duly certified and authenticated by the seal of the board, shall be received in evidence in all courts equally and with like effect as the original. Public inspection of records kept in the office of the board under the authority of this chapter shall be permitted by applicable provisions of the Open Records Act of the Commonwealth of Kentucky, KRS 61.870 to 61.884. Effective: June 25, 2009 History: Amended 2009 Ky. Acts ch. 70, sec. 16, effective June 25, 2009. -- Amended 1990 Ky. Acts ch. 170, sec. 13, effective July 13, 1990. -- Created 1962 Ky. Acts ch. 251, sec. 18.
